Transaction

817d426ef368eb304c63787d5a3d7111464c7853ff2bc2686ade4eaa4b2a23ea
293,872 confirmations
Timestamp
1599613246
Block647,390
Fee678 sats
Fee rate3 sats/vB
view on mempool.space

Inputs & Outputs